About Michael B. Ranke

Michael B. Ranke is a scholar working on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ism, Genetics, Molecular Biology,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health and Surgery, having authored 342 papers that have together received 14.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Growth Hormone and Insulin-like Growth Factors (183 papers), Sexual Differentiation and Disorders (69 papers), Genetic Syndromes and Imprinting (44 papers), Birth, Development, and Health (39 papers), Genetic and Clinical Aspects of Sex Determination and Chromosomal Abnormalities (38 papers), Pituitary Gland Disorders and Treatments (29 papers), Lipid metabolism and disorders (26 papers) and Childhood Cancer Survivors' Quality of Life (24 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ism (7.6k citations), Genetics (5.0k citations),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health (3.0k citations), Reproductive Medicine (689 citations) and Molecular Biology (5.4k citations). Michael B. Ranke has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Gerhard Binder, Werner Blum, Martin W. Elmlinger, Anders Lindberg, Kerstin Albertsson‐Wikland, Patrick Wilton, C.J.H. Kelnar, J.M. Wit, Roland Schweizer and J. R. Bierich. Their work appears in journals such as Hormone Research in Paediatrics, The Journal of Clinical Endocrinology & Metabolism, Acta Paediatrica, European Journal of Pediatrics and European Journal of Endocrinology.
